Output 80590d6821c7032fc7c5d5a7cb1b3a97e694eb738d0e2dbc97cb506e132a3be2: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9141f998dd910d357b4bb4abfefec6153c24117f OP_EQUAL
address
3Ew4wP6TX6QWqy5DoS9vPQTFtc4rZjfcnY
transaction
80590d6821c7032fc7c5d5a7cb1b3a97e694eb738d0e2dbc97cb506e132a3be2
spent
true